Output e364b539039347ee065ae3bac5b86db60ba6d9a89906c930fd417daab69ad27f:0

value
17988479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3bc625605d6ee731dae9fa8aedb6f3cdad2528f OP_EQUAL
address
3KXyN7HVJCjD4swcdG8P2Kudhs9NMyi4kJ
transaction
e364b539039347ee065ae3bac5b86db60ba6d9a89906c930fd417daab69ad27f
spent
true